Specifications
- Shape / Type: Carbide Jobber Drill
- Cut Type: Carbide Jobber Drill
- Head Diameter: 0.51 mm (0.02 inch)
- Shank Diameter: Standard jobber size
- Overall Length: 1-1/4 inch
- Flute Length: 1/4 inch
- Helix Angle: 20 degrees
- Point Angle: 118 degrees, four-facet split point
- Tolerance: Diameter +.000/-.0005 inch
- Material Compatibility: Hard metal drilling

Installation and Maintenance Guide
Setting It Up
- Make sure the drill chuck is clean before installation for a firm grip
- Insert the carbide jobber drill fully into the chuck to prevent wobbling
- Tighten the chuck securely to avoid slippage during operation
- Check drill alignment before starting to ensure straight drilling
- Use the appropriate drill speed to match material hardness
Keeping It Going
- Clean the drill bit regularly to remove metal debris and prevent buildup
- Inspect the cutting edges frequently for signs of wear or damage
- Use cutting fluid to reduce heat and extend tool life when drilling metals
- Store drills in a dry place to avoid rust and corrosion
- Replace the drill if tolerance or cutting performance noticeably declines
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What materials can these Carbide Jobber Drills be used on?
They are suitable for drilling in hard metals and other tough materials where carbide's strength is needed.
Q: What is the significance of the 118-degree four-facet split point?
This point design helps prevent the drill from walking and ensures more accurate hole placement.
Q: What sizes are available for these drills?
This specific SKU is 0.51 mm (0.02 inch) diameter; other sizes may be available on request.
Q: How does the 20-degree helix impact drilling performance?
The 20-degree helix angle optimizes chip removal while maintaining rigidity for clean, efficient cuts.
Q: Can I use these drills on wood or plastic?
While designed for metal, they can work on harder plastics but are not optimized for softer materials like wood.
Q: What is the recommended drill speed?
Drill speed varies based on material; generally, slower speeds for harder metals help extend tool life.
Q: How precise are these drills?
They have a tight diameter tolerance of +.000/-.0005 inch for precise hole making.
Q: Are these drills compatible with standard drill chucks?
Yes, they are made to fit standard jobber drill sizes and typical drill chucks.
